What is the Form 990-EZ 2014?

The Form 990-EZ 2014 is a crucial document used by exempt organizations to report their financial activities to the Internal Revenue Service (IRS). This federal tax form includes various sections designed to capture essential information, such as revenue, expenses, and program service accomplishments. It plays a significant role in ensuring transparency and compliance with tax regulations for 501(c)3, 527, and other qualifying organizations.
Organizations utilize this form to demonstrate their commitment to accountability in their financial dealings. By adhering to reporting requirements, they contribute to trust and credibility among stakeholders, donors, and the general public.

Who Needs the Form 990-EZ 2014?

Certain nonprofit organizations are mandated to file the Form 990-EZ. Eligibility criteria hinge on the organization’s type and financial thresholds, determining whether the form is applicable.
  • 501(c)3 organizations, which are charitable entities.
  • 501(c)4 and other tax-exempt organizations such as 527 political organizations.
  • Organizations with gross receipts below specific thresholds are often required to file.
Not all organizations need to file; some may qualify for exemptions based on their size or structure.

When and How to File the Form 990-EZ 2014

Filing the Form 990-EZ requires attention to specific deadlines and an organized process. Organizations should be aware of important dates to ensure timely submission to the IRS.
  • The filing deadline for most organizations is the 15th day of the 5th month after the end of the fiscal year.
  • Step-by-step, organizations should gather necessary documentation, accurately fill out the form, and review details for accuracy.
  • Forms can be submitted electronically or via paper filing, depending on the organization’s preference.

Organizations exempt from income tax under IRS section 501(c), 527, or 4947(a)(1) that had gross receipts under $200,000 are typically required to file Form 990-EZ annually.
Form 990-EZ is usually due on the 15th day of the 5th month after the organization's fiscal year ends. Extensions can be requested if needed.
Form 990-EZ can be submitted electronically through authorized e-file providers or mailed to the IRS location specified in the form instructions, depending on the organization's preference.
Before starting, gather financial statements, details on revenues and expenses, a list of programs, and information on board members to ensure all required sections are filled accurately.
Common errors include omitting required fields, failing to review for accuracy, and missing the filing deadline. Double-check all entries before submission to avoid penalties.
Processing times can vary, but the IRS typically takes 4-6 weeks to process Form 990-EZ. Delayed processing may occur during peak filing periods.
There are generally no fees to file Form 990-EZ with the IRS, but organizations should confirm if they are using service providers or software that may charge for filing assistance.
